Sundowns win against SuperSport United to go 14 points clear

Mamelodi Sundowns came out on top in the Tshwane Derby as a goal from Neo Maema secured a narrow 1-0 win against SuperSport United at Loftus Versveld Stadium on Monday evening. 

The first big chance of the match came as early as the fifth minute when the ball fell to Thapelo Maseko on the edge of the box. Maseko fired a curling shot from out wide, forcing Sundowns goalkeeper Ronwen Williams into making a big save to keep the scores level. 

SuperSport United made a strong start to the match, as they made it a theme to press Sundowns high and win possession close to the opposition's box. 

Maseko had his second chance of the half shortly after the 10th minute, as he found himself in the box with just Williams to beat, but he failed to hit the target, firing his shot just wide of the post. 

Sundowns grew into the game after a slow start. The home team showed their goal threat from a set-piece as Marcelo Allende made a deep cross to the back-post to find the head of Rushine de Reuck, whose header flew just wide of the net. 

The away side showed their quality and threat with a few chances in the first 30 minutes of the game but struggled to find the opening goal they were after. 

Sundowns continued to threaten the visitors, with their biggest chance coming after the half-hour mark, when Gaston Sirino fired a dangerous ball across the goal, narrowly missing the feet of all players in the box. 

Maseko and SuperSport had a penalty shout denied after the forward was brought down in the box by Khuliso Mudau, with the referee deciding that it was a fair challenge.
